Why are we going through the Bible? Because we want to make sense of our world. God's Word brought order, life, light, clarity, and purpose in the beginning. Everything starts and ends with God, and the Bible is the instrument he uses to help us make sense of our lives.
As we think about the Creation Story, we see that it is foundational to understanding our world and ourselves. This is the starting point for the overarching story of Scripture: Creation, Fall, Redemption, and the Restoration of all things.
Here's how it works:
Monday through Friday, you'll read some of the more major scripture passages accompanied by thoughts from pastors and writers. Then, on Saturday and Sunday, you'll take a break from reading to reflect on how to apply what you're learning and who you can share it with.
